flag The International Judo Federation (IJF) has reversed its ban, allowing Russian athletes to compete under their national flag, anthem, and team colors starting at the Abu Dhabi Grand Slam on November 28, 2025. flag The decision, made by the IJF’s executive committee, marks a shift from previous restrictions that required Russian athletes to compete as neutrals after Russia’s 2022 invasion of Ukraine. flag The IJF cited fairness, inclusivity, and the sport’s global unity as key reasons, emphasizing that athletes should not be punished for government actions. flag The move follows the reinstatement of Belarusian athletes and comes despite ongoing suspensions of Russia’s Olympic committee by the IOC. flag While the Ukrainian Judo Federation criticized the decision, the IJF maintains that sport should remain separate from geopolitics.
